We've built a product that identifies malnutrition among hospitalized patients, and closes both care and coding gaps in real time using AI. It works. Now we need someone to take it to market โ€” build the playbook, close the first cohort, and turn this into a business line. If you've done something like this before in healthcare, keep reading.
About the Role
Weโ€™re looking for a high-impact leader to serve as the Area Vice President for Care Gap & Coding Automation, and lead the development and scaling of a new solution area within Qventus. This role sits at the intersection of sales, product development, and clinical care. It encompasses hospital operations, inpatient management, revenue cycle, CDI, and AI-driven workflow automation.
You will be responsible for shaping a new business line โ€” from early traction (starting with malnutrition) to a scalable, repeatable offering that drives both clinical and financial outcomes for health systems. This is a highly entrepreneurial role requiring strong domain expertise, product intuition, and the ability to operate in ambiguity while building toward scale.
